Skip to content

Fix SERIAL1_PROTOCOL RCIN (23) showing as Megasquirt in Serial Ports #36

@rubenCodeforges

Description

@rubenCodeforges

Description

In the Serial Ports configuration, SERIAL1_PROTOCOL set to 23 (RCIN for ELRS) displays as "Megasquirt" instead of the correct protocol name. The protocol list mapping is incorrect.

Steps to Reproduce

  1. Connect a flight controller with SERIAL1_PROTOCOL set to 23
  2. Navigate to Vehicle Config > Serial Ports
  3. Observe that SERIAL1 shows "Megasquirt" instead of "RCIN"

Expected vs Actual

  • Expected: Protocol 23 should display as "RCIN" or "RC Input"
  • Actual: Protocol 23 displays as "Megasquirt"

Environment

  • ELRS receiver on SERIAL1
  • SERIAL1_PROTOCOL = 23

Source: Discord (codeforges)
Severity: medium
Label: Bug
Discord Message IDs: 1474667983052865566

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Projects

    Status

    Backlog

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ions